AAMIE MASON After an 18-year career as a Speech-
Language Pathologist, Aamie felt led by the Lord to pursue
further education in the area of counseling. Following her 2018 graduation from John Brown
University with her M.S. in Marriage and Family Therapy, she joined Living Well Counseling as a Licensed Counselor. She has been
married to her husband, David, for almost 27 years and has served alongside him in ministry all of those years. David serves as pastor
at Walnut Valley Baptist Church in Hot Springs. The couple has three daughters, Ashlyn Mason Johnson (25), Laura Katheryn Mason (21), and Kimee Mason (15).
